#222d05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#222d05 is composed of 13.3% red, 17.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.9%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 76.5 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 9.8%. #222d05 color hex could be obtained by blending #445a0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#222d05 color description : Very dark (mostly black) green.
#222d05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#222d05 has RGB values of R:34, G:45,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2239749.
